   1// SPDX-License-Identifier: GPL-2.0
   2#include <linux/dma-map-ops.h>
   3#include <linux/dma-direct.h>
   4#include <linux/iommu.h>
   5#include <linux/dmar.h>
   6#include <linux/export.h>
   7#include <linux/memblock.h>
   8#include <linux/gfp.h>
   9#include <linux/pci.h>
  10
  11#include <asm/proto.h>
  12#include <asm/dma.h>
  13#include <asm/iommu.h>
  14#include <asm/gart.h>
  15#include <asm/x86_init.h>
  16#include <asm/iommu_table.h>
  17
  18static bool disable_dac_quirk __read_mostly;
  19
  20const struct dma_map_ops *dma_ops;
  21EXPORT_SYMBOL(dma_ops);
  22
  23#ifdef CONFIG_IOMMU_DEBUG
  24int panic_on_overflow __read_mostly = 1;
  25int force_iommu __read_mostly = 1;
  26#else
  27int panic_on_overflow __read_mostly = 0;
  28int force_iommu __read_mostly = 0;
  29#endif
  30
  31int iommu_merge __read_mostly = 0;
  32
  33int no_iommu __read_mostly;
  34/* Set this to 1 if there is a HW IOMMU in the system */
  35int iommu_detected __read_mostly = 0;
  36
  37extern struct iommu_table_entry __iommu_table[], __iommu_table_end[];
  38
  39void __init pci_iommu_alloc(void)
  40{
  41        struct iommu_table_entry *p;
  42
  43        sort_iommu_table(__iommu_table, __iommu_table_end);
  44        check_iommu_entries(__iommu_table, __iommu_table_end);
  45
  46        for (p = __iommu_table; p < __iommu_table_end; p++) {
  47                if (p && p->detect && p->detect() > 0) {
  48                        p->flags |= IOMMU_DETECTED;
  49                        if (p->early_init)
  50                                p->early_init();
  51                        if (p->flags & IOMMU_FINISH_IF_DETECTED)
  52                                break;
  53                }
  54        }
  55}
  56
  57/*
  58 * See <Documentation/x86/x86_64/boot-options.rst> for the iommu kernel
  59 * parameter documentation.
  60 */
  61static __init int iommu_setup(char *p)
  62{
  63        iommu_merge = 1;
  64
  65        if (!p)
  66                return -EINVAL;
  67
  68        while (*p) {
  69                if (!strncmp(p, "off", 3))
  70                        no_iommu = 1;
  71                /* gart_parse_options has more force support */
  72                if (!strncmp(p, "force", 5))
  73                        force_iommu = 1;
  74                if (!strncmp(p, "noforce", 7)) {
  75                        iommu_merge = 0;
  76                        force_iommu = 0;
  77                }
  78
  79                if (!strncmp(p, "biomerge", 8)) {
  80                        iommu_merge = 1;
  81                        force_iommu = 1;
  82                }
  83                if (!strncmp(p, "panic", 5))
  84                        panic_on_overflow = 1;
  85                if (!strncmp(p, "nopanic", 7))
  86                        panic_on_overflow = 0;
  87                if (!strncmp(p, "merge", 5)) {
  88                        iommu_merge = 1;
  89                        force_iommu = 1;
  90                }
  91                if (!strncmp(p, "nomerge", 7))
  92                        iommu_merge = 0;
  93                if (!strncmp(p, "forcesac", 8))
  94                        pr_warn("forcesac option ignored.\n");
  95                if (!strncmp(p, "allowdac", 8))
  96                        pr_warn("allowdac option ignored.\n");
  97                if (!strncmp(p, "nodac", 5))
  98                        pr_warn("nodac option ignored.\n");
  99                if (!strncmp(p, "usedac", 6)) {
 100                        disable_dac_quirk = true;
 101                        return 1;
 102                }
 103#ifdef CONFIG_SWIOTLB
 104                if (!strncmp(p, "soft", 4))
 105                        swiotlb = 1;
 106#endif
 107                if (!strncmp(p, "pt", 2))
 108                        iommu_set_default_passthrough(true);
 109                if (!strncmp(p, "nopt", 4))
 110                        iommu_set_default_translated(true);
 111
 112                gart_parse_options(p);
 113
 114                p += strcspn(p, ",");
 115                if (*p == ',')
 116                        ++p;
 117        }
 118        return 0;
 119}
 120early_param("iommu", iommu_setup);
 121
 122static int __init pci_iommu_init(void)
 123{
 124        struct iommu_table_entry *p;
 125
 126        x86_init.iommu.iommu_init();
 127
 128        for (p = __iommu_table; p < __iommu_table_end; p++) {
 129                if (p && (p->flags & IOMMU_DETECTED) && p->late_init)
 130                        p->late_init();
 131        }
 132
 133        return 0;
 134}
 135/* Must execute after PCI subsystem */
 136rootfs_initcall(pci_iommu_init);
 137
 138#ifdef CONFIG_PCI
 139/* Many VIA bridges seem to corrupt data for DAC. Disable it here */
 140
 141static int via_no_dac_cb(struct pci_dev *pdev, void *data)
 142{
 143        pdev->dev.bus_dma_limit = DMA_BIT_MASK(32);
 144        return 0;
 145}
 146
 147static void via_no_dac(struct pci_dev *dev)
 148{
 149        if (!disable_dac_quirk) {
 150                dev_info(&dev->dev, "disabling DAC on VIA PCI bridge\n");
 151                pci_walk_bus(dev->subordinate, via_no_dac_cb, NULL);
 152        }
 153}
 154DECLARE_PCI_FIXUP_CLASS_FINAL(PCI_VENDOR_ID_VIA, PCI_ANY_ID,
 155                                PCI_CLASS_BRIDGE_PCI, 8, via_no_dac);
 156#endif
